Breaking Down the Ingredients

To fully grasp Dairy Queen‘s use of corn syrup, let’s delve into the ingredients of some of its most popular items:

Blizzards

Dairy Queen’s signature Blizzards, a harmonious blend of ice cream and mix-ins, contain corn syrup as a key ingredient. The mix-ins, such as candy pieces and cookie dough, often contribute additional corn syrup to the equation.

Soft-Serve

The creamy foundation of Dairy Queen’s soft-serve, while not explicitly listing corn syrup, does contain high-fructose corn syrup (HFCS), a sweetener derived from corn.

Other Products

Corn syrup also makes an appearance in various other Dairy Queen products, including:

  • Milkshakes
  • Sundaes
  • Banana Splits
  • Dipped Cones

Health Implications

The presence of corn syrup in Dairy Queen’s products has raised concerns among health-conscious consumers. Corn syrup is a high-glycemic index sweetener, meaning it can cause a rapid spike in blood sugar levels. Excessive consumption of corn syrup has been linked to weight gain, diabetes, and other health issues.
